Full job description

Join Our Team!

We are looking for a motivated and detail-oriented Manufacturing Technician to join our team. In this role, you will support daily manufacturing operations by operating production equipment, performing quality checks, and ensuring products meet customer and company standards. The ideal candidate is safety-focused, willing to learn, and takes pride in producing high-quality work.

Key Responsibilities

  • Identify and communicate process or operational issues to the Production Manager.

  • Learn and operate a variety of manufacturing equipment, including:

  • Ultrasonic Cleaning Line

  • Incoming Inspection processes

  • Printing Line

  • Manual and automatic cut-off machines

  • Learn and understand part number conventions and product specifications.

  • Complete required quality records, inspection forms, and production documentation accurately.

  • Follow all company safety policies, procedures, and work instructions.

  • Maintain a clean and organized work environment through proper housekeeping practices.

  • Perform additional duties and responsibilities as assigned to support team and production goals.

Qualifications

  • High School Diploma or GED required; or one to two years of related manufacturing experience and/or training; or an equivalent combination of education and experience.

  • Ability to read and understand work instructions, operating procedures, and maintenance documents.

  • Ability to complete in-process inspection documentation accurately.

  • Basic math skills, including the ability to perform calculations using standard formulas with or without a calculator.

  • Ability to understand and follow written, verbal, and visual instructions.

  • Strong attention to detail and commitment to quality and safety.

  • Ability to work effectively as part of a team in a fast-paced manufacturing environment.
